1-(2-Bromo-phen-yl)-3-(4-chloro-butano-yl)thio-urea
Abstract:
The asymmetric unit of the title compound, C(11)H(12)BrClN(2)OS, consists of two crystallographically independent mol-ecules. In each mol-ecule, the butano-ylthio-urea unit is nearly planar, with maximum deviations of 0.1292 (19) and 0.3352 (18) Å from the mean plane defined by nine non-H atoms, and is twisted relative to the terminal benzene ring with dihedral angles of 69.26 (7) and 82.41 (7)°. An intra-molecular N-H⋯O hydrogen bond generates an S(6) ring motif in each butano-ylthio-urea unit. In the crystal, N-H⋯O hydrogen bonds link the two independent mol-ecules together, forming an R(2) (2)(12) ring motif. The mol-ecules are further connected into a tape along the c axis via N-H⋯S and C-H⋯S hydrogen bonds.
